Further Information
Oak Barrels made from local oak have been used in France for centuries to store and age wine, given the oak and vanilla overtones they impart.
The barrels from which these planters are cut were used for one season before being decommissioned and imported to the UK for Round Wood Trading.
They have a capacity of over 100 litres, (just under 25 imperial gallons), and were produced using high grade Oak from the surrounding regions. Only 5% of an Oak Tree is deemed of good enough quality to produce wine barrels.
Their light look makes them perfect for sitting on a decking area. Finishes/colours may vary slightly as these are produced from natural materials.
They are also suitable to use for collecting water. Water butts are extremely environmentally friendly. Rainwater is ideal for use in any garden; it’s not subject to a hose-pipe ban, it’s free, natural and organic.
Maintenance
Oak can darken and silver through time and the effects of weathering. This process will, however, take a while and can be prevented/delayed through regular pressure washing. Alternatively, a protective oil/sealant can be applied to the planters.
